The internet access for ATIS comes with a personal email account hosted by the ISP.  I use it little, but use it enough to realize that for some reason they don't have spam configured to download through POP/IMAP access through email clients.   I have to log into my account on their web page to see my spam.  Maybe that's where yours is?

Also, often you can "whitelist" email from certain sources with the ISP.   They should leave email from those sources untouched if you do that.  That often resolves delivery problems from mailing lists in general.
